A core closure is typically a cylindrical or cylindrical-like object formed from sturdy materials like plastic, metal, or cardboard. Its main purpose is to seal the open ends of cores or tubes, preventing the contents from falling out or becoming damaged. This is particularly valuable when dealing with materials such as fabric, paper, film, or adhesive tape, which are often wound around a core for easy handling.
One of the key advantages of core closures is their ability to secure the wound materials tightly, minimizing the risk of unraveling during handling, shipping, or storage. This ensures that the contents remain neat, organized, and protected from any potential damage. Additionally, core closures allow for effortless stacking, enabling better utilization of space and increased storage capacity.

Plastic core closures are popular due to their durability, resistance to moisture and chemicals, and ease of use. Metal core closures are often preferred for heavy-duty applications where additional strength and security are required. Cardboard core closures are commonly used in the textile industry due to their cost-effectiveness and recyclability.
